Hurtigruten Debuts North America East Coast Itineraries

Hurtigruten debuts East Coast trips Coastal Gems itineraries in April of 2018 through Canada, US Eastern Seaboard, Miami, and Halifax

April 1, 2017 - Upcoming Hurtigruten itineraries along the American and Canadian east coast offers everything from sleepy southern charm to exciting northern cities, from cultural treasures to remote nature reserves. Inviting explorers to experience the rich diversity of the American seaboard.

Highlights of the trip include:

  • Crossing Baffin Bay from Canada to Greenland
    • Arctic expedition, exploring the unspoiled regions on both sides of Baffin Bay
    • St. Johns, Canada – Kangerlussuaq, Greenland (15-day)
  • Exploring the Arctic Land of the Caribou
    • Travel through time to a different world, where the vast Arctic landscapes, wild animals and small settlements remain as if untouched by man
    • Copenhagen/Narsarsuaq, Denmark - St. John's, Canada (15-day)
  • Coastal Gems of America - Southbound
    • North America’s eastern seaboard, offers a striking variety of cultures, historic sites, and dramatic natural scenery.
    • Halifax, Canada – Miami, Florida (13-day)
  • Coastal Gems of America - Northbound
    • Starting in Miami, sailing into New York to experience the Big Apple, and discovering Maine’s magnificent coast, before completing the journey in Halifax, Canada.
    • Miami, Florida – Halifax, Canada (13-day)
  • Discovering the Untouched Beauty of Greenland and Arctic Canada
    • Discover Newfoundland and Labrador´s towering mountains, massive rock faces, deep forests and infinite supply of lakes and rivers.
    • Copenhagen, Denmark - Halifax, Canada (17-day)
  • A Voyage Through Arctic Canada and Iceland
    • Rugged Atlantic coastline of Canada features evergreen forests, rolling farmland, breathtaking mountains, and remote settlements.
    • Halifax, Canada – Reykjavik, Iceland (14-day)

About Hurtigruten:

Hurtigruten is the world leader in exploration travel and the largest cruise operator in Antarctica, sailing to the most remote destinations as well as year-round along Norway's coast. The company’s fleet of intimate ships, which each carry 100 to 646 guests, allows travelers to enjoy the scenery and culture of the destination in a relaxed atmosphere. Hurtigruten is building the world’s first hybrid cruise ship. Hurtigruten recently joined the USTOA, United States Tour Operators’ Association, recognized for its dedication to integrity in tourism.
